Output edc639aeb2840d30291c510b91453154d3576a2b81c4589fdeb657113534c2d8:8

value
262144
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d5930a364c933b9537f10f87dbbaf7d104120abd9ba864856a9f02c104492967
address
bc1p6kfs5djvjvae2dl3p7rahwhh6yzpyz4anw5xfpt2nupvzpzf99nsdeu43y
transaction
edc639aeb2840d30291c510b91453154d3576a2b81c4589fdeb657113534c2d8
confirmations
11861
spent
true